I've been using the serialization library for a while now. Because of
the run-time module loading aspect of our project, serialization has to
be available through virtual functions and we do this by wrapping calls
to boost serialization using poylmorphic archive types. In general,
this has worked well.

We'd like to start using the 1.35 branch because we want access to
Boost.mpi as well. Rebuilding the code against 1.35 works fine and
doesn't require any changes. However, as soon as we try running any
code, we get the following missing symbol problem (this is happening
when run-time loading a library that links against boost_serialization):

undefined symbol:
_ZN5boost7archive6detail27archive_pointer_iserializerINS0_27polymorphic_binary_iarchiveEEC2ERKNS_13serialization18extended_type_infoE

Any ideas on what could be going on here? I'm running revision 41959
built with GCC 3.4.
